Athens: We have huge losses due to sanctions on Russia

Athens has paid a high price for EU sanctions against Russia.

Axar.az reports that the statement came from Greek Deputy Foreign Minister Miltiadis Varvichiotis.

"Thanks to EU sanctions against Russia, our country has had to pay great economic value for the export of its products to Russia," he said.
